India and the EU finalized the historic Free Trade Agreement during the 16th India-EU Summit today. Co-chaired by António Costa and Ursula von der Leyen, the “mother of all deals” covers two billion people. It aims to double trade by 2032, significantly slashing tariffs on European cars, wines, and Indian textiles.
